New Delhi, May 20: A Border Security force (BSF) jawan on Sunday allegedly committed suicide by shooting himself after murdering his wife, Rajni Kumari in Trichy city of Chennai. The deceased was identified as Ranjit and is a resident of Bihar Sharif town. Mother of the wife has alleged that it was a case of dowry, however, Ranjit’s family members have not issued any comments on the incident so far.
According to reports, Rajni worked in the Railways and was paid a decent amount. Ranjit used to demand money from her time to time. It once happened that Ranjit asked for 3.65 lakh from Rajni; she gave him the asked amount. After seven months, when she asked Ranjit to return the amount, he denied. They used to quarrel over it.
On May 19, Ranjeet tried to add poison to his wife’ drink but failed to kill her. Later, he shot her to death with a service revolver and then, shot himself too. He was also taken to a Police Sadar Hospital in a critical condition, where he died late at night. The couple is survived by a daughter who was at maternal grandmother’s house at the time of the incident.
